Abstract / Summary

A case published by the Ecodesign Centre, Wales from an interview conducted with D.Masterton and Dr Katie Beverly.

The case study established ways in which Masterton had embedded sustainable design thinking and practice within the academic curriculum on BA(Hons) Sustainable Product Design, Falmouth University

The case study was published as a electronic PDF and distributed as part of the conference proceedings.
